Martin Boyce, 'No Brilliantly Coloured Birds' (detail), 6 colour screenprint on Heritage White (315gsm) paper, 2009. Edition of 40. Signed, numbered and dated by artist. £450 plus VAT (unframed).

Martin Boyce is one of Scotland's most prominent artists working today and his nomination and subsequent Turner Prize 2011 win reflects the stature of his practice and the critical acclaim and recognition it continues to receive.

Dundee Contemporary Arts (DCA) has developed a series of prints with Martin Boyce at DCA Print Studio, presenting a remarkable collecting opportunity. The works are available to view on DCA's website or by appointment and can also be purchased online. Own Art is available to help you spread the cost of the artwork both at the gallery and online.

As part of the curatorial programme, DCA works directly with artists to develop limited edition artworks. DCA, uniquely for a gallery of its standing, houses a world-class facility for the production of printed art works. Artistic production is central to the creative mission and DCA prides itself on being able to invite artists to work on site in a state-of-the-art Print Studio.

The print featured was commissioned and printed at Dundee Contemporary Arts. This edition was released to coincide with the Scotland and Venice 2009 exhibition, No Reflections as part of the 53rd International Art Exhibition – La Biennale di Venezia.
